diff options
author | tmpfile <tmpfile@users.noreply.github.com> | 2017-05-14 13:40:55 -0300 |
---|---|---|
committer | Natanael Copa <ncopa@alpinelinux.org> | 2017-06-09 13:12:06 +0000 |
commit | 919a7023941a246c06457d0912bf7748a8b19b06 (patch) | |
tree | 1580f54e87c24fe2644cc335a8b102f8251ca57f /main/fcgi | |
parent | 8bca3c6b8441f17559d220f7fd77ef813dc933fa (diff) | |
download | aports-919a7023941a246c06457d0912bf7748a8b19b06.tar.bz2 aports-919a7023941a246c06457d0912bf7748a8b19b06.tar.xz |
main/fcgi: modernize abuild
Diffstat (limited to 'main/fcgi')
-rw-r--r-- | main/fcgi/APKBUILD | 38 |
1 files changed, 9 insertions, 29 deletions
diff --git a/main/fcgi/APKBUILD b/main/fcgi/APKBUILD index be49f0a27d..aacc69319d 100644 --- a/main/fcgi/APKBUILD +++ b/main/fcgi/APKBUILD @@ -19,14 +19,10 @@ source="http://distfiles.alpinelinux.org/distfiles/$pkgname-$pkgver.tar.gz CVE-2012-6687.patch " +builddir="$srcdir/$pkgname-$pkgver" prepare() { - cd "$srcdir/$pkgname-$pkgver" - for i in $source; do - case $i in - *.patch) msg "Applying $i" - patch -p1 -i "$srcdir"/$i || return 1;; - esac - done + default_prepare + sed -i -e 's/AM_CONFIG_HEADER/AC_CONFIG_HEADERS/' configure.in libtoolize --force && aclocal && autoconf \ @@ -34,8 +30,7 @@ prepare() { } build() { - cd "$srcdir/$pkgname-$pkgver" - + cd $builddir export LIBS="-lm" ./configure \ --build=$CBUILD \ @@ -44,16 +39,15 @@ build() { --sysconfdir=/etc \ --mandir=/usr/share/man \ --infodir=/usr/share/info \ - --enable-shared \ - || return 1 + --enable-shared # work around parallel build issue - make -C libfcgi libfcgi.la || return 1 - make || return 1 + make -C libfcgi libfcgi.la + make } package() { - cd "$srcdir/$pkgname-$pkgver" - make DESTDIR="$pkgdir" install || return 1 + cd $builddir + make DESTDIR="$pkgdir" install } @@ -63,20 +57,6 @@ xx() { mv "$pkgdir"/usr/lib/*++* "$subpkgdir"/usr/lib/ } -md5sums="d15060a813b91383a9f3c66faf84867e fcgi-2.4.0.tar.gz -6d6d15f05721284b63b173ab6e728ecb configure.patch -2e72c834db21da6af3f77dd2b36727a2 fcgi-2.4.0-gcc44_fixes.patch -8c07165aed574b853326ae25fe9af291 fcgi-2.4.0-Makefile.am-CPPFLAGS.patch -d2654525f06451c99b8cdd4cc00a963b 20-fcgi-2.4.0-clientdata-pointer.patch -f26b536786f70b30a2d91c83d56e944c 30-fcgi-2.4.0-html-updates.patch -02900e5f2400ed2982db1e02c4a17aa8 CVE-2012-6687.patch" -sha256sums="66fc45c6b36a21bf2fbbb68e90f780cc21a9da1fffbae75e76d2b4402d3f05b9 fcgi-2.4.0.tar.gz -5dfa0465d08b4d87e4e30caefa3702c73e8f7eb634f584305fccd3b63ee65e24 configure.patch -c31eb921a662b53401a88caafbadb16b02ae809d25d0b6d8b1ac96d20803e9d5 fcgi-2.4.0-gcc44_fixes.patch -df132dec038246ce9526f311c5d00ec103427111722c476f78069d7f1386529f fcgi-2.4.0-Makefile.am-CPPFLAGS.patch -27936406b5fcb13096bbdd80ee7eb0cf262e5c2b983e79e41d17a3cd17387683 20-fcgi-2.4.0-clientdata-pointer.patch -df8b2eb4c017fedf6f27a5650e2f4f5636e66ec7d02d20a50282edbc8d636c69 30-fcgi-2.4.0-html-updates.patch -7fc1e0af1c71d7b86d1a90595fbadedbb01db0731b9e91b17fb5437680bb4e96 CVE-2012-6687.patch" sha512sums="38164d11112e834b30c6f809da4e184021e8d22ec8db2c49ad827895a75b99dc1824b94831304aa0ae1174176fe64d02a12882b1a00b780119600bdc39a90927 fcgi-2.4.0.tar.gz 57ae87e526c6fbc39b81b93b0fa2d159315f4d06f9a58053a5636bb3377955c3d92024f2363af483bf4c22b7f3c888d1f1505e265f77e8a1b690740cf5909959 configure.patch 6dafc960c30c1c9f5e09eff0fa71a0202265e063b9ccc56b82d58961f4a2e290734dcea06bd45ea58abc5a394db6edbaed4ccac5dc1fcfa22f0595917fa24243 fcgi-2.4.0-gcc44_fixes.patch |